Footnote

Front

A citation in a document placed at the bottom of the page in the document on which the citation is located; formatted as single spaced with hanging indent and double spaced between according to the MLA guidelines

Back

Hyperlink

Front

A block of text or a graphic that when mouse-clicked takes the user to a new location to an internal or external page.

Back

Citation

Front

Excerpt from the source of information.

Back

HTTP

Front

How data is transferred through the servers. Stands for Hypertext Transfer Protocol

Back

Caption

Front

A line of text that describes an object.

Back

MLA style

Front

A standardization of guidelines used by colleges and universities for research papers.

Back

Tab leader

Front

The symbols that appear in a table of contents between a topic and the corresponding page number.

Back

Plagiarism

Front

Illegal use of someone's work

Back

Source

Front

Where you acquire the information. A source can come from a book, Web, interview, etc.

Back

Header

Front

Content that appears on the top of the page.

Back

Works cited

Front

A list of sources referred to in the document and is placed at the end of the document. Also referred to as a works cited page.

Back

Bibliography

Front

A list of sources referred to in the document and is placed at the end of the document; also referred to as a works cited page.

Back

Table of contents

Front

An ordered list of the topics in a document, along with the page numbers on which they are found. Usually located at the beginning of a long document.

Back

Table of authorities

Front

A specialized type of bibliography used in legal documents. It lists all of the legal citations in a document and the page numbers on which they are located.

Back

Endnote

Front

A citation in a document placed at the end of the document in which the citation is located.

Back

Footer

Front

Content that appears on the bottom of the page

Back

Bookmark

Front

A location or selection of text that you name and identify for future reference.
